What is the price range of a hotels with jacuzzi in room in Georgia?
Hotel prices in Georgia for rooms with a jacuzzi can differ significantly depending on the city, the hotel’s rating, and season. In Atlanta, upscale hotels like the Four Seasons Hotel Atlanta or the St. Regis Atlanta might offer rooms with jacuzzis, with rates ranging from $300 to over $600 per night. More affordable options such as Country Inn & Suites by Radisson could offer rooms with jacuzzis starting around $100 to $200 per night. In Savannah, hotels such as the Kimpton Brice Hotel or the Planters Inn might offer rooms with jacuzzis ranging from $200 to $400 per night. These prices are approximate and can vary, so it’s always recommended to check current rates directly with the hotel or via a reliable booking platform.

Are there beachfront hotels in Georgia with Jacuzzi in the room?
Yes, Georgia has several beachfront hotels with rooms that include a Jacuzzi, particularly on Tybee Island and near the coastal city of Savannah. These hotels offer the unique experience of enjoying a relaxing soak while being just steps away from the beach. Prices and amenities vary, so it’s advisable to book early, especially during peak beach seasons, to secure a room with a Jacuzzi and enjoy the serene beach atmosphere.
